We will discuss situations when the knees just start to ache or feel slightly uncomfortable. If your knee has already suffered a ligament tear, cartilage damage, or a meniscus tear, you will need to see a doctor and take a break from training for an extended period. Possible causes of discomfort. And is squatting to blame?If you experience unpleasant sensations in your knees, it's essential to analyze possible causes and take corrective measures. We will consider the situation assuming there are no complaints regarding your squatting technique. 1. Most often, knees cannot handle the load for those trying to combine squats with running or jumping, including jump rope. This combination usually goes painlessly at a junior age and almost always leads to injuries at a veteran level. The age at which you'll have to give up jumping and running depends on your weight, genetics, and lifestyle. If your knees already hurt - it means it's time. 2. Many athletes save time on warm-up. Beginners can do this with no consequences and often get used to skipping warm-ups. As training weights increase over the years and the athlete ages, this bad habit eventually leads to injuries. To prevent them, the warm-up should be enhanced with training experience. 3. Sometimes, cold hinders knee recovery between workouts. A decrease in body temperature by 1 degree slows metabolic processes in tissues by 13-18%, and cooling by 3 degrees - by one and a half times! This is very significant. Those who do not load their knees can walk in the cold in ripped jeans or tights. If you want to squat a lot, you'll need to keep your knees warm. Sometimes wearing warm underwear or knee pads under your pants outdoors alleviates aching pain within a few days. This works even at temperatures close to freezing. Just because you don’t feel cold doesn’t mean your knees maintain an optimal temperature for recovery processes. 4. Deterioration of blood circulation can hinder recovery. For instance, if you spend your workday sitting with your legs bent under the chair, or you have to work in uncomfortable static positions, standing on a stepladder, etc. In these cases, regular breaks with position changes and warm-ups, as well as self-massage, will help. The bad habit of sitting cross-legged leads to blood stagnation not only in the legs but also in the pelvic area. This can provoke varicose veins, knee pain, and many other issues. 5. Chronic dehydration reduces the amount of synovial fluid. For athletes, dehydration most often occurs during weight cutting. It can also arise from excessive use of certain medications, saunas, alcohol... 6. Pressure on the knees from the floor. Repairs, floor washing, playing with children - some people do this while kneeling. However, knees are not designed for this. Comfortable protective knee pads from IKEA can be bought for less than a tube of ointment or pills needed for treatment. More about the warm-upThe warm-up should correspond to the exercise you are about to perform. Running will not prepare you for squats or bench pressing. Running warms up the body, but warming up and a warm-up are not synonymous! Various types of squats will prepare you for squats: Before squatting, it's essential to warm up the lower back; for this, the following are great: It is advisable to use all the listed exercises. Veterans should do more than one set. The recommended duration of warm-ups according to physical education textbooks is 30-40 minutes, which is not practiced in gyms. Only when staying in a sports camp can a person afford such luxury. To achieve the desired effect in a shorter time, before the warm-up, apply warming ointment on the knees and wear knee pads (medical, not too tight) to maintain warmth. Between warm-up sets, perform self-massage of the knees, as this is perhaps the simplest type of self-massage. Combining these actions will prepare even old knees for squatting in about 20 minutes. Which Exercises to DoThe knees are most at risk when descending, and the faster the descent, the greater the traumatic load on your ligaments. The rebound is necessary to achieve results in squatting, especially during "wrap work". However, if your knees start to "act up", it’s advisable to temporarily refrain from using the rebound until unpleasant symptoms disappear. Definitely exclude hack squats and sissy squats, as they apply increased load on the knees at any descent speed. To maintain muscle tone, you can use exercises that eliminate rapid descent. Once your knees return to normal, you can return to your usual exercises with minimal loss of working weights. 1. Squat on a Block Set the block at a height that allows for a depth appropriate for powerlifting standards. Descend smoothly! Try to touch the block with your glutes as far from your feet as possible. Ideally, pause at the lowest point for 1-2 seconds. This exercise is very beneficial for teaching technique to beginners. 2. Squat with a Pause at the Bottom Everything is as in the previous exercise, but you will need to determine the depth of the squat based on your feelings, not by relying on a mirror. Even experienced athletes will occasionally need depth control from a third party. If there is no experienced judge in the gym, you can use video feedback. You can make the exercise more challenging. If you take 5 seconds to lower yourself, you'll need lower working weights, thereby reducing the load on your knees, while still effectively working the muscles, possibly even more so. 3. Box Squat If knee pain increases at sharp angles, you can squat only within the range that does not cause discomfort. Choose a box of appropriate height. Perform it like a squat on a block; working weights will be significantly heavier. This exercise cannot be done without safety assistants. Dropping the bar onto the box will damage the equipment at best and cause injury at worst. 4. Rack Pulls You can perform this alone in the gym. Set the bar at a height from which your knees can work relatively pain-free today. To successfully lift, it’s crucial to assume the correct starting position. The vertical projection of the bar should pass through the centers of your ankle joints. The centers of gravity for both the equipment and the athlete must be aligned vertically. The skill of achieving this starting position comes with experience. After lifting, lower the bar smoothly, avoiding any bouncing. Perform each subsequent lift after relaxing in the lower position. Which Cyclical Activities to Combine Squats for Joint Benefits?Many athletes rightfully believe their bodies should receive not only strength training. Some need aerobic load for fat burning, while others have different goals. Today, it is common to use the term "cardio," but it distorts the meaning, creating the impression that only the heart is being trained. Aerobic activities train not only the cardiovascular system but also pulmonary function and skeletal muscles, providing a comprehensive impact on the body. To achieve this, one should choose one (or several) cyclical sports. Strength results in squats will suffer from any aerobic activity, except swimming. 1. Long-Distance Running will negatively affect your squats and knees with 100% certainty. Short sprints up to 100 meters, preferably on sand or deep snow, and uphill are less harmful. However, sprinting is not aerobic; it is an anaerobic load. Swimming clearly does not harm the knees and can actually benefit squat performance. 1. All types of rowing are practically safe for the knees, but there is a risk of overloading the back when combined with heavy pulling. 2. Combining with speed skating is relatively safe. However, you won't be able to move too fast on ice rinks, as they are usually crowded with hockey players and casual skaters. Moving on frozen rivers and canals is not always possible everywhere or at all times. 3. Brisk Walking is significantly better than running and is accessible to anyone with legs, anytime. It’s still best to avoid hard surfaces. Walk on dirt, sand, or snow, preferably with inclines. Nordic walking is likely even more beneficial for the body as a whole, but if your knees are already hurting, walking may make things worse. 4. Skiing. Classic and skating styles are essentially different sports. The first is unlikely to harm your knees and will provide excellent aerobic load to your body. The second is also good in terms of aerobics, but it stresses the outer collateral ligament in an unnatural way; the human leg is designed for walking, not for repeated lateral push-offs. 5. Cycling. Under certain conditions, it can benefit your knees. The repeated movements from pedaling stimulate the production of synovial fluid, which protects your knees from wear. By "repeated movements," we mean thousands of pedal rotations; doing 20 squats in this context is negligible. Considering the balance of benefits and accessibility, cycling is the best aerobic activity for athletes, and it will be discussed in more detail. 6. Scooter. Adults have become actively interested in scooters in recent years. There are currently no observations on knee effects. Presumably, it will not be harmful and won't have therapeutic effects either. With regular use, it’s essential to periodically switch the pushing and supporting legs for balanced development. Scooters are quite convenient for getting aerobic exercise while commuting to work or other places. They are inferior to bikes in terms of speed and carrying capacity, as there is no place to hang bags, a frame bag, or a child’s seat. However, they are convenient for transport on the subway and surface transport, which is a significant advantage in urban environments. More About CyclingAthletes should not blindly follow the advice given by racers to racers. Our goals and speeds differ. Additionally, your pedals will likely be standard, while racers often use clipless ones. Since many bicycle sellers are former or current racers, they will recommend exactly the model on which they became prize winners in nationwide competitions. However, your bicycle should meet your requirements. Seating position: Athletes should not hunch their backs. Air resistance increases approximately proportionally to the square of speed. The average speed in professional races is about 45 km/h, while the average for tourists is 20 km/h. All else being equal, racers experience five times more air resistance. You can comfortably disregard resistance in favor of a straight back and comfort. Use all possibilities to raise the handlebars; if necessary, change the stem and install a "V"-shaped BMX handlebar. https://www.instagram.com/p/BJUc7UfgCoS/?taken-by=nikolai_coach. Weight: An extra dozen kilograms is actually beneficial; it increases the training effect. Carbon frames are unnecessary; aluminum works just fine. But a true athlete should have a robust steel bike with large wheels and a stock of food on the rack. It’s tough climbing hills – dismount and push the bike, preferably running, for more variety in your workout. If the elevator breaks, dragging it up 14 flights will give you a workout with crossfit elements. Shock absorbers are for show-offs. Your strong legs are the best shock absorbers. By frequently rising from the saddle, you also reduce blood stagnation. Standing uphill is beneficial too. Your core works excellently when you pull the handlebars toward you while riding upright. Ideally, you should spend up to a third of the time standing for health benefits during your ride. Saddle position: The differences from racing standards aren’t significant. While sitting on the saddle, you should be able to reach the pedal with your heel. You can lift the saddle a few centimeters higher to ensure proper foot engagement. The larger the angles in your knees while pedaling, the better it is for them. It's advisable to move the saddle as far back as possible for maximum comfort of the knees. Practice shows that to maintain healthy knees, one should accumulate at least 3000 km of road cycling or a bit over 2000 km on dirt per year, equating to approximately 150 hours of pedaling. For producing synovial fluid, it's the time, not the distance, that matters. Not everyone can find 150 hours for a second sport. However, cycling and scootering can be advantageous because they can replace other activities like skiing, skating, rowing, or swimming – you can use them on your way to work, the gym, or the store... Often, this results in a time gain. In winter, it is safer to ride on public roads with studded tires; for rural roads (with compacted snow, not ice), cross-country tires are sufficient.
